Shaded Writers welcome Queer, Trans, Intersex, Black, Indigenous, People of Colour (QTIBiPOC) to a writing group for and facilitated by QTIBiPOC supported by Hackney Libraries. It is hybrid; the virtual component delivered via zoom.

Book virtual event: https://www.eventbrite.co.uk/e/shaded-writers-x-hackney-libraries-online-writing-workshop-for-qtibipoc-tickets-1272691286899

A mix of creative prompts and mindfulness will be offered. A moment to pause, reflect and create. Bring your favourite beverage/snacks and your coloured pens or your picture making equipment. Bring your pen and paper, lappy, phone - however you create. Come ready to write/draw/doodle/journal (as you choose), free and to prompts, to and for yourself. Come to enjoy the ambience of being in community. There is no expectation you should share, though you are welcome to.

It is suitable for writers at any level and non-writers wishing to engage creatively.

It will be held as gentle space of invitation and relaxation and finding your own level of participation, no judgement, no pressure. There is no obligation to put your camera or audio on if joining via zoom. It is held as safe(r) space and will not be recorded. Speak the Word Poetry Salon is an online poetry collective that PJ Samuels and nudi co-organise. Other poets holding space for the collective include Maureen Medina, Nona Lea, Tara Singh, NJ Holt, Tanya Denhere and Tarrine Khanom. We host twice-per-week free-access poetry writing, editing and journaling workshops, open mics, and ad hoc literary events.

We're welcoming, queer-led, and queer and trans-affirming.

The sessions are popular but low-key, relaxed, run as a safer space, close-captioned and working towards better accessibility.
